Output 343c374863c6affc0e95e119b13eb17497be0f1fedf0210f653326d492266a8f:1

value
10232395
script pubkey
OP_0 OP_PUSHBYTES_20 ec523a3f9dec4e6b05b71bf892368a5f4b480b5f
address
bc1qa3fr50uaa38xkpdhr0ufyd52ta95sz6ldjyyp8
transaction
343c374863c6affc0e95e119b13eb17497be0f1fedf0210f653326d492266a8f
confirmations
131686
spent
true